Key Technical Highlights
Supply Voltage: 24 VDC nominal — compatible with standard industrial panel power rails
Maximum Load Current: 12A per channel — supports high-inrush actuator loads
Output Configuration: Digital switching outputs (sourcing & sinking selectable)
Operating Temperature Range: -40°C to +70°C — rated for extreme ambient conditions
Redundancy Support: 1oo2 and 2oo3 voting architectures within HIMA SIS platforms
Hot-Swap Capability: Module replacement without system shutdown — minimizes process interruption
Built-in Diagnostics: Short-circuit detection, overload protection, channel-level fault reporting via system bus
Protection Rating: IP20 — suitable for enclosed control cabinet installation
Compliance: IEC 61511, API 670, ISO 20816, CE certified
Country of Origin: Germany
Vertical Industry Applications
Petrochemical & Refining: The X-DO 24 01 is widely deployed in emergency shutdown (ESD) systems at refinery units, where its fail-safe output behavior prevents catastrophic process deviations. Its deterministic response time reduces system downtime during safety function activation.
Oil & Gas Upstream/Midstream: Offshore platforms and pipeline SCADA systems rely on this module for wellhead control and compressor station automation. Its wide temperature tolerance ensures stable operation in harsh marine and desert environments.
Power Generation: Turbine protection circuits and boiler management systems integrate the X-DO 24 01 to execute fast-acting trip commands. Its redundancy support aligns with the high-availability demands of grid-connected generation assets.
Mining & Minerals Processing: Conveyor interlock systems and crusher protection panels benefit from the module’s robust load-handling capacity and diagnostic transparency, reducing unplanned stoppages in continuous production environments.
Chemical & Pharmaceutical Manufacturing: Batch process control systems in regulated industries use this DCS Hardware to maintain precise output sequencing, supporting GMP compliance and process repeatability across production campaigns.
Data Sheet & Specifications
| Property | Detailed Value |
|---|---|
| Full Model Number | X-DO 24 01 |
| Manufacturer | HIMA Paul Hildebrandt GmbH |
| Product Category | Digital Output Module — DCS Hardware / SIS I/O |
| Supply Voltage | 24 VDC (±10%) |
| Output Channels | 24 digital output channels |
| Max Load Current per Channel | 12 A |
| Output Signal Type | Discrete switching (sourcing / sinking configurable) |
| Galvanic Isolation | Yes — channel-to-channel and channel-to-bus |
| Operating Temperature | -40°C to +70°C |
| Storage Temperature | -40°C to +85°C |
| Protection Class | IP20 |
| Mounting | DIN rail / HIMA backplane rack |
| Hot-Swap Support | Yes |
| Redundancy Architecture | 1oo2, 2oo3 (within HIMA SIS platform) |
| Communication Interface | HIMA system bus / Fieldbus compatible |
| Applicable Standards | IEC 61511, IEC 61508, API 670, ISO 20816, CE |
| Country of Origin | Germany |
